Transaction e37a71394d39fd9308376bcc851c82bda8b56dad88b25f147c5a5fd09a1d9569
1 Input
1 Output
-
e37a71394d39fd9308376bcc851c82bda8b56dad88b25f147c5a5fd09a1d9569:0
- value
- 664625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2dded1f7a55d449c66a616c21a59a5c24883cfa OP_EQUAL
- address
- 3KTNsTyKXLbCpuip7QJegDGsoQxVHvEYJ9